In the latest edition of Berlingske Tindende there is a nice article about the Crown Prince couple in which they talk about their lives with their children and so forth.
They note the difficulties as well as day to day challenges, "balance" is key, of being parents to two young children whereupon they explain how both, Christian and Isabella, have two completely opposite personalities. They go on to thank the thousands of Danish citizens who sent them baby gifts, and they are happy for the thoughtfulness of the Danes.

Berlingske also had a lengthy interview with the couple - where they talk about their everyday life.
* They try to spend as much a time as possible with Isabella and Christian, especially mornings and evenings.
* They asked people they knew with children on how to raise them - Frederik asked Joachim, who had boys, especially with the first one.
* Mary was quite surprised at the news that Frederik apparently had a horrible childhood, because from the things he's told he, it had seemed like a happy one where they spent a lot of time together, even if it might not have been the meals, which Frederik confirms.
* Isabella is teething at the moment, and therefore up in the nights. As she sleeps in Mary and Frederiks room, it means less time for sleep for them.
* Isabella has much more temprament than Christian - much more happy and much more angry.
* It is important to them to both give the children privacy, but at the same time make them used to the media circus in which they'll be living - and bring them to smaller arrangements when possible so they can get used to it. They also hope that the children will be able to make their mistakes growing up outside the spotlights, and like that the press respects Christian's day care and that he can be without cameras there.
* Christian is getting in the "present-age" for Christmas. The parents think that he should only get enough so that he can properly appreciate them.
Kronprinsparret - kapitel 1: »Vi begynder dagen med at lave havregrød« - Danmark
The second part of the interview is about their work.
* Mary chose fashion as a starting point because it is important for Denmark, but it is also something that isn't overly complicated as a beginner's patronage. She was surprised at the attention - and don't think she would've got the same "branding" if she had chosen wind-mills as her first patronages. As time goes on, she has chosen to move more into social areas.
* They're trying to figure out how they want to prepare for their lives as King and Queen.
* They want to prepare Christian as much as possible for the future he has in front of him.
